The Conversion: 45 Pounds to Kilograms
The conversion factor between pounds and kilograms is approximately 0.453592. Put another way, one pound is equal to 0.453592 kilograms.
45 pounds * 0.453592 kg/lb ≈ 20.41 kilograms
Which means, 45 pounds is approximately equal to 20.41 kilograms.
Even so, for many practical purposes, rounding to one or two decimal places is sufficient. So, we can comfortably say that 45 pounds is approximately 20.4 kilograms.

Beyond the Conversion: Understanding Weight and Mass
you'll want to distinguish between weight and mass. While often used interchangeably in everyday conversation, they represent distinct physical quantities.

-
Mass: Mass is a measure of the amount of matter in an object. It remains constant regardless of location. The kilogram is the standard unit of mass.
-
Weight: Weight is a measure of the force of gravity acting on an object's mass. Weight varies depending on the gravitational field. Here's a good example: an object will weigh less on the moon than on Earth because the moon's gravitational pull is weaker.
The conversion from pounds to kilograms primarily deals with mass. While we commonly use the term "weight" when dealing with pounds and kilograms, the conversion implicitly addresses the mass of the object, assuming a consistent gravitational field (like that on Earth).

Q4: What about ounces to grams?
A4: Since 1 pound is equal to 16 ounces and 1 kilogram is approximately 1000 grams (1000g), you can use this relationship for conversions between ounces and grams. First convert ounces to pounds (divide by 16), then convert pounds to kilograms (multiply by 0.453592), and finally convert kilograms to grams (multiply by 1000).
